SEC v. Edward S. Walczak

UnknownFiled: January 26, 2020

Edward S. Walczak allegedly misrepresented to investors how he managed risk in the Catalyst Hedged Futures Strategy Fund. According to the SEC, Walczak told investors that the Fund employed a risk management strategy involving safeguards to prevent losses of more than 8%, when in fact no such safeguards limited losses and Walczak did not otherwise consistently manage the Fund to an 8% loss threshold. The complaint further alleged that, between December 2016 and February 2017, the Fund breached certain risk parameters and Walczak failed to take the required corrective action. The fund lost more than $700 million.
